Some ammo comes on “stripper clips”, which facilitate the rapid insertion of that ammo into a magazine. The magazine is then inserted into the magazine well of a rifle.
Clips and magazines are not the same thing, but are too often interchanged by the “journalists”, and now some political LEO’s, as well.
